Nahdat wa Tanweer El Rahawa Association was Denied Registration
On 14/6/2006, the Ministry of Social Solidarity – Giza Department has refused to register an Association for the Rights of Youth and Farmers in El Rahawa village, although on 13/4/2006 the founders have presented all of the valid and completed documents satisfying and fulfilling the stipulations of law no. 84 for the year 2002 concerning national associations. The founders wanted to establish an association called "Nahdat wa Tanweer El Rahawa". The message of the association is to support farmers rights, develop the economic, social, cultural and educational conditions and protect agricultural workers, especially those who work in digging wells.
The Ministry of Social Solidarity – Giza Department has refused to register the association without presenting any reason, which is a violation to the law of associations and a violations against farmers rights to assembly and freedom of expression, this action also violates international human rights covenants and agreements.
The LCHr is preparing a challenge to the refusal decisions because of the abuse of authority. This decision paralyzes the efficiency of civil society activists. The non-declaration of an association without any reason is a violation to the Egyptian law, article no. 20 of the world announcement for human rights and article no. 22 of the international covenant for civil rights. This violation is an interference in the judiciary jurisdiction or authority, which make all of its decision in this regard invalid.
